Cursor Composer 2 Sparks Kimi Row
A Reddit thread claims Cursor's new Composer 2 coding model is basically Kimi K2.5 with reinforcement-learning fine-tuning. The post says Moonshot AI says it was neither paid nor asked for permission, turning the launch into a provenance and attribution fight.
// ANALYSIS
If the allegation sticks, this is less a model-launch story than a trust story: developers will care not just about benchmark wins, but about where the model came from and whether the sourcing is clean.
- –Cursor officially frames Composer as a frontier coding model trained with RL and tool use for long-horizon agentic work, so the claim directly challenges the launch narrative.
- –If a competitor can be repackaged with RL on top, the moat shifts from raw model novelty to data, tooling, workflow integration, and distribution.
- –Moonshot's reported denial raises the stakes beyond internet drama; licensing, partnership norms, and model provenance are now part of the product story.
- –Most developers will still judge it on speed, cost, and coding quality, but enterprise teams are likelier to ask harder questions before they adopt it broadly.
